public override void AddContact(Contact contact)
{
var penetrationConstraint = penetrationConstraintPool.Pop();
penetrationConstraint.Setup(this, contact);
penetrationConstraints.Add(penetrationConstraint);
var frictionConstraint = frictionConstraintPool.Pop();
frictionConstraint.Setup(this, penetrationConstraint);
frictionConstraints.Add(frictionConstraint);
}